Zen Technologies Soars to New Heights in 2023 with Explosive Growth in Defence Sector

In an astounding surge, Zen Technologies, an aerospace and defence company, has witnessed a remarkable 372% increase in its stock price throughout 2023, surpassing the 7% rise in the S&P BSE Sensex. This meteoric rise has been driven by a potent combination of robust financial results, a strong order book, and a promising outlook for the defence industry.

Unveiling New Peaks:

Shares of Zen Technologies recently hit an upper circuit, reaching an all-time high of Rs 869.1 per share. This achievement comes on the heels of an impressive 44% rally in just eight days, attributed to an ever-growing order book and stellar results from the June-ended quarter.

Explosive Growth Trajectory:

Over a span of six weeks, the company's stock price has surged an astonishing 110%, reflecting the unwavering investor confidence in its potential. The astounding 474% YoY increase in net profit for Q1FY24, coupled with a nearly four-fold rise in total income, underscores the remarkable financial performance of Zen Technologies.

Driving Forces Behind Success:

Zen Technologies specialises in indigenous design, development, and manufacture of sensors and simulators technology-based defence training systems. The company's range includes land-based military training simulators, driving simulators, live range equipment, and anti-drone systems. The substantial growth was fueled by successful execution of simulation exports and domestic anti-drone orders.

Strategic Government Collaborations:

The company has received commendable orders, including a significant Rs 64.97 crore order from the Ministry of Defence. With an order book position of approximately Rs 1,000 crore, Zen Technologies anticipates capitalising on national initiatives like Make In India, Atmanirbharata, and Buy Indian IDDM, as well as the government's focus on defence and sustainability commitments.

Global Expansion on the Horizon:

With increasing geopolitical tensions and improved international relations, Zen Technologies sees promising opportunities in export markets. The company's focus on simulators and anti-drone systems aligns with the rising demand for advanced defence solutions worldwide.
